Overview of PDC Crown Drill Bits

PDC crown drill bits are essential tools in the drilling industry, particularly for applications requiring high efficiency and durability. These bits utilize Polycrystalline Diamond Compact (PDC) technology, which enhances their performance by providing superior wear resistance and cutting efficiency compared to traditional materials.

The design of PDC crown drill bits typically features a series of diamond cutters strategically placed on a steel body. This configuration allows for optimal penetration rates, minimizing the time and cost associated with drilling operations. As a result, more companies are turning to PDC crown drill bits for their ability to handle various geological conditions effectively.

Moreover, the manufacturing process of PDC crown drill bits involves advanced techniques that ensure precision and quality. The combination of diamond material and robust engineering provides these bits with the capability to operate in challenging environments, making them a popular choice among drilling professionals.

Applications of PDC Crown Drill Bits

PDC crown drill bits are widely used across various industries, including oil and gas, mining, and construction. Their versatility makes them suitable for different types of drilling projects, from exploratory drilling to production wells. The ability to penetrate hard rock formations efficiently is one of the key reasons for their popularity in these sectors.

In the oil and gas industry, PDC crown drill bits are employed to maximize drilling speed and minimize downtime. This efficiency translates into significant cost savings for operators, as faster drilling times lead to quicker project completions. Additionally, the durability of PDC bits reduces the frequency of replacements, further enhancing their value.

In the mining sector, these drill bits are utilized for both surface and underground drilling applications. Their robustness allows them to withstand harsh conditions while maintaining operational effectiveness. As a result, PDC crown drill bits have become a staple in achieving optimal productivity and safety in mining operations around the world.
